Colorado Springs has mild temperatures. But it can get a bit cold during winters. Summer brings hot temperatures. But it also has the highest rainfall. Autumn and spring temperatures are mild. (Perfect in my opinion!) There really is no bad time to visit Colorado Springs!

If you’re looking for things to do in Colorado Springs, Garden of the Gods is the number one result. But there is good reason.

Garden of the Gods is a 1,300 acre park that is completely dog ​​friendly. Miles of trails to keep you and your pup entertained!

Well, this is a very touristy stop. But it’s a dog-friendly stop. You and your pup can walk across the bridge to the Royal Gorge Park grounds on the bridge to take a photo with your state emblem. And marvel at the gondola floating above the colossal gorge (see below).

How cool are dog-friendly gondolas?! Definitely worth the 1.5 hour drive from Colorado Springs. After crossing the suspension bridge you and your pup can board the gondola for a gondola ride.

Tips:: You can take the gondola before or after crossing the bridge. We found the line much shorter if you cross the bridge first. Then take the gondola back.

A mountain made for riding! If you don’t want to hike the 14 miles, it takes about 2-3 hours to get in your car to the top of Pikes Peak, but you’ll get great views the entire time.

There are many areas to stop, take photos and have a picnic along the way. If you’re feeling extra adventurous you can even book a ride up and rent a bike on the way down!

Tip: Don’t forget to bring warm clothes. Because the top is cooler. And since there is no gas station, prepare at least 1/2 tank of gas.

With miles of trails open to off-leash dogs, Boulder’s color-coded dog rules map gives you specific rules for every trail in Boulder. (If you are checking a specific route or trailhead just type the name at the top to zoom into the path) 

See also  Where Is The Best Place For A Family Vacation

Traveling to Chautauqua to go hiking? On weekends and summer holidays you can avoid the hassle of parking and take advantage of the free park-to-park shuttle, where dogs are allowed! Find all the details here.

All boulder trails allow dogs. You must have a dog leash. As already mentioned, the City of Boulder’s Sound and Sight tag program allows registered dogs to access designated off-leash trails. If the dog shows a special engagement tag and is under “voice and vision control” of the handler at all times. If you and your dog are visiting Boulder for an extended period of time or are in town frequently, you may want to get audio and visual badges as well. View program details here.
